Training Supervisor - Med D

Position Summary
The Supervisor of Training Delivery is a leadership position in Learning & Performance responsible for leading a team of Trainers to deliver effective training in a job-specific area with a focus on teaching specific areas of knowledge, skills or capabilities needed for certain positions. The Supervisor of Training Delivery will provide feedback on instructor-led courses and e-learning modules and will influence material design and development. The Supervisor will regularly communicate training progress and outcomes with leaders. The Supervisor of Training Delivery will develop short and long-term goals and will oversee all aspects of Training Delivery. The Supervisor will regularly meet with other qualified Trainers and Subject Matter Experts to determine target learning levels, audience, learning objectives, delivery methods, and training materials.
Primary
Responsibilities:
Develop a high performing team with emphasis on individual skill development, continuous improvement and standardization.
Develop short-term and long-term goals to support the business, identify and align with existing business requirements, lead change, and anticipate future business needs.
Support and collaborate with business leaders to address training needs that meet business objectives.
Establish metrics and goals for the team and define and develop areas for improvement.
Support other areas of the business by sharing best practices, providing tools, and sharing resources.
Partner with business leaders across multiple business units.
Manage training projects by developing plans for prioritizing and ensuring they meet deadlines and objectives.
Build and maintaining a talented team capable of delivering high quality results that are valued by the organization.
Building and maintaining strong relationships across the organization and with other business units both with business and training counterparts.
Work well with senior leaders, peers and subordinates.
Seek opportunities to enhance and expand team member ' s competencies.
Lead team to facilitate surveys and focus groups. Coordinate training programs and assess effectiveness.
Lead training of skills such as computer applications, phone systems, assembly, policies, procedures, interpersonal, etc.
Coordinate structured learning experiences outside of the classroom as needed.
Support curriculum design and development partners which may include research, development, creating and writing technical training materials that could include manuals, quick reference job aids, PowerPoint presentations and other training support materials.
Travel when warranted. Up to 30-50% travel may be required.
Perform other duties as required.
This position may be filled at any of our current PBM Mail Operations facilities where we have trainers. AZ-Phoenix, PA- Pittsburgh, IL- Mount Prospect, TX, San Antonio, PA- Wilkes-Barre

Preferred Qualifications
PBM industry knowledge preferred.
Excellent presentation, written and oral communication skills.
Ability to provide effective coaching and feedback.
Demonstrated leadership and motivational skills.
Strong interpersonal and relationship-building skills.
Excellent coordination, scheduling, problem solving, time management, attention to detail and organization skills.
Strong analytical skills to include the ability to collect, organize, evaluate and present data and make recommendations to improve programs.
Basic understanding of human performance improvement methodology.
Is proactive and has strong interpersonal skills.
Ability to support multiple programs simultaneously and can effectively prioritize.
Fosters a non-threatening and supportive team and training environment.
Required Qualifications
Demonstrated ability to lead teams and provide successful results.
Demonstrated ability to determine key business issues and develop appropriate action plans.
Ability to effectively lead the delivery and training of multi-faceted program material.
Ability to lead collaboratively in a cross-functional environment and with remote team members.
Familiarity with conferencing tools, e-learning software, learning management systems, SharePoint, screen capture and other training productivity tools and strong knowledge and demonstrated experience with MS appl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
Knowledge of adult learning principles and sound instructional design practices in order to help connect reporting and analytics to recommendations.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
